summ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orPaul de Vrieze <pauldv@gentoo.org>2003-11-06 10:19:14 +0000
committerPaul de Vrieze <pauldv@gentoo.org>2003-11-06 10:19:14 +0000
commit56b1cb2a3991d3ab8b0abf9136387c85ab185894 (patch)
tree48e62a3b459be542ea61b6acf18bc92c294cd787 /dev-libs
parentclean out old versions of ebuild (diff)
downloadgentoo-2-56b1cb2a3991d3ab8b0abf9136387c85ab185894.tar.gz
gentoo-2-56b1cb2a3991d3ab8b0abf9136387c85ab185894.tar.bz2
gentoo-2-56b1cb2a3991d3ab8b0abf9136387c85ab185894.zip
Add ||die to the 0.9.6 lib install commands
Diffstat (limited to 'dev-libs')
-rw-r--r--dev-libs/openssl/ChangeLog6
-rw-r--r--dev-libs/openssl/Manifest36
-rw-r--r--dev-libs/openssl/openssl-0.9.7c-r1.ebuild6
3 files changed, 26 insertions, 22 deletions
diff --git a/dev-libs/openssl/ChangeLog b/dev-libs/openssl/ChangeLog
index d166fca1f85e..d36b93854822 100644
--- a/dev-libs/openssl/ChangeLog
+++ b/dev-libs/openssl/ChangeLog
@@ -1,6 +1,10 @@
# ChangeLog for dev-libs/openssl
# Copyright 2002-2003 Gentoo Technologies, Inc.;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/dev-libs/openssl/ChangeLog,v 1.56 2003/11/04 16:36:41 aliz Exp $
+# $Header: /var/cvsroot/gentoo-x86/dev-libs/openssl/ChangeLog,v 1.57 2003/11/06 10:19:07 pauldv Exp $
+
+ 06 Nov 2003; Paul de Vrieze <pauldv@gentoo.org> openssl-0.9.7c-r1.ebuild:
+ Add checks so that missing 0.9.6 libs when they should be there will cause the
+ ebuild to fail, so saving from mishap
*openssl-0.9.6l (04 Nov 2003)
*openssl-0.9.7c-r1 (04 Nov 2003)
diff --git a/dev-libs/openssl/Manifest b/dev-libs/openssl/Manifest
index 64716f29dcde..26564b46c768 100644
--- a/dev-libs/openssl/Manifest
+++ b/dev-libs/openssl/Manifest
@@ -1,26 +1,26 @@
-MD5 f110bafc5ab22d7c5529adddca5c9312 openssl-0.9.7b-r3.ebuild 4790
-MD5 32be56655c507e0c2441f98eb42a4503 openssl-0.9.6l.ebuild 3055
-MD5 5bfe1187da645375b143f7490b36b4e8 openssl-0.9.7c.ebuild 4828
+MD5 1c42db33e41e66bb651776ec42d1ee7e ChangeLog 9690
MD5 cc5d4327e09d6e8dcdd73153425b93f4 openssl-0.9.6k-r1.ebuild 3071
-MD5 69ad81d01cbeb155e1238e208018f7bd openssl-0.9.6k.ebuild 2601
-MD5 5826e9d9c3f0f165002368663da938a7 openssl-0.9.7c-r1.ebuild 4833
-MD5 578cb1799fe7b95b932e92bc8adb4b8f ChangeLog 9490
+MD5 5bfe1187da645375b143f7490b36b4e8 openssl-0.9.7c.ebuild 4828
+MD5 32be56655c507e0c2441f98eb42a4503 openssl-0.9.6l.ebuild 3055
+MD5 f110bafc5ab22d7c5529adddca5c9312 openssl-0.9.7b-r3.ebuild 4790
MD5 37236013e0d26d43c6bff35a8a48e8ec metadata.xml 220
MD5 861241a3156c82351f2fd10fa2433c03 openssl-0.9.7b.ebuild 3318
-MD5 7483d6f0412e857e9063dce4aecf2991 files/openssl-0.9.7c-gentoo.diff 936
-MD5 cebd09d1819c07b0fab14ad90b0da884 files/openssl-0.9.6j-gentoo.diff 1591
-MD5 a5a379391dfaaef98e4fe4198ff2ed2c files/openssl-0.9.6i-blinding.patch 1717
-MD5 cebd09d1819c07b0fab14ad90b0da884 files/openssl-0.9.6k-gentoo.diff 1591
-MD5 e4af813471d470d25fb77231d324ad1c files/digest-openssl-0.9.6k 67
-MD5 05f27ed666e4f0927ce09b79abc606b2 files/digest-openssl-0.9.6l 67
-MD5 ec3ece282da08b6e27d213ee22c00208 files/digest-openssl-0.9.7b 67
+MD5 69ad81d01cbeb155e1238e208018f7bd openssl-0.9.6k.ebuild 2601
+MD5 7f3de540ca4bba26adcd0cff25419502 openssl-0.9.7c-r1.ebuild 4905
MD5 8ad6215b1b4c9d53c435ceff6b537e35 files/digest-openssl-0.9.7c 134
-MD5 7483d6f0412e857e9063dce4aecf2991 files/openssl-0.9.7a-gentoo.diff 936
-MD5 cebd09d1819c07b0fab14ad90b0da884 files/openssl-0.9.6l-gentoo.diff 1591
-MD5 e4af813471d470d25fb77231d324ad1c files/digest-openssl-0.9.6k-r1 67
+MD5 05f27ed666e4f0927ce09b79abc606b2 files/digest-openssl-0.9.6l 67
+MD5 e4af813471d470d25fb77231d324ad1c files/digest-openssl-0.9.6k 67
MD5 55db5f2d56b9146b7d7cae1353a0e0c4 files/digest-openssl-0.9.7b-r3 134
-MD5 f8b9ae9e3ed08f964620aa832aec4d0c files/digest-openssl-0.9.7c-r1 134
+MD5 cebd09d1819c07b0fab14ad90b0da884 files/openssl-0.9.6j-gentoo.diff 1591
+MD5 ec3ece282da08b6e27d213ee22c00208 files/digest-openssl-0.9.7b 67
+MD5 b901850df9952252974316e78775673b files/openssl-0.9.6-mips.diff 1487
MD5 7483d6f0412e857e9063dce4aecf2991 files/openssl-0.9.7b-gentoo.diff 936
+MD5 e4af813471d470d25fb77231d324ad1c files/digest-openssl-0.9.6k-r1 67
+MD5 cebd09d1819c07b0fab14ad90b0da884 files/openssl-0.9.6k-gentoo.diff 1591
+MD5 a5a379391dfaaef98e4fe4198ff2ed2c files/openssl-0.9.6i-blinding.patch 1717
MD5 cebd09d1819c07b0fab14ad90b0da884 files/openssl-0.9.6i-gentoo.diff 1591
MD5 e47009f3748b8b56f2a2859405dc1b41 files/openssl-0.9.6i-klima_pokorny_rosa_attack.patch 2144
-MD5 b901850df9952252974316e78775673b files/openssl-0.9.6-mips.diff 1487
+MD5 7483d6f0412e857e9063dce4aecf2991 files/openssl-0.9.7c-gentoo.diff 936
+MD5 f8b9ae9e3ed08f964620aa832aec4d0c files/digest-openssl-0.9.7c-r1 134
+MD5 7483d6f0412e857e9063dce4aecf2991 files/openssl-0.9.7a-gentoo.diff 936
+MD5 cebd09d1819c07b0fab14ad90b0da884 files/openssl-0.9.6l-gentoo.diff 1591
diff --git a/dev-libs/openssl/openssl-0.9.7c-r1.ebuild b/dev-libs/openssl/openssl-0.9.7c-r1.ebuild
index 084d457f9bbd..d6e23b536513 100644
--- a/dev-libs/openssl/openssl-0.9.7c-r1.ebuild
+++ b/dev-libs/openssl/openssl-0.9.7c-r1.ebuild
@@ -1,6 +1,6 @@
# Copyright 1999-2003 Gentoo Technologies, Inc.
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/dev-libs/openssl/openssl-0.9.7c-r1.ebuild,v 1.1 2003/11/04 16:36:41 aliz Exp $
+# $Header: /var/cvsroot/gentoo-x86/dev-libs/openssl/openssl-0.9.7c-r1.ebuild,v 1.2 2003/11/06 10:19:07 pauldv Exp $
inherit eutils flag-o-matic gcc
@@ -142,8 +142,8 @@ src_install() {
# openssl-0.9.6
test -f ${ROOT}/usr/lib/libssl.so.0.9.6 && {
- dolib.so ${WORKDIR}/${OLD_096_P}/libcrypto.so.0.9.6
- dolib.so ${WORKDIR}/${OLD_096_P}/libssl.so.0.9.6
+ dolib.so ${WORKDIR}/${OLD_096_P}/libcrypto.so.0.9.6||die "libcrypto.so.0.9.6 not found"
+ dolib.so ${WORKDIR}/${OLD_096_P}/libssl.so.0.9.6|| die "libssl.so.0.9.6 not found"
}
}